AUGUSTUS, 27 B.C.- A.D. 14. AR Denarius (3.49 gms), Uncertain mint in Spain, Possibly Colonia Patricia, 19-18 B.C. NGC Ch AU, Strike: 4/5 Surface: 2/5.
RIC-75a; RSC-210. Obverse: Bare head right; Reverse: Oak wreath with the two ties drawn up across center; OB CIVIS above, SERVATOS below. Struck on a compact flan with some scattered, minor roughness, this example offers solid detail and a charming cabinet tone.
